Output d972588d6056351160a2520861aed6e7aeb33a186b25b4cfd8a27ca556c9f684:1

value
107269535
script pubkey
OP_0 OP_PUSHBYTES_20 58adf25c9a20997fdc47479496c5489e5a158321
address
ltc1qtzklyhy6yzvhlhz8g72fd32gnedptqeps86w9q
transaction
d972588d6056351160a2520861aed6e7aeb33a186b25b4cfd8a27ca556c9f684
spent
true